Why Read Israel Literature?

Reading literature from Israel is one of the most direct ways to understand a culture from the inside — through its language, its obsessions, its myths, and its silences. The books that have earned international recognition from Israel are not merely local stories but works that have found readers worldwide precisely because they address universal concerns with particular vividness and honesty.
